Step-by-Step: What to Do When a Pipe Bursts Under Your Sink​

While our skilled technicians are on their way to your home, mitigating the immediate water flow will save you thousands of dollars in structural damage. Follow this rapid-response checklist:

  1. Shut Off the Angle Stops: Look for the two small, oval-shaped valves on the wall directly behind the sink. Turn the valve connected to the leaking line clockwise to cut the water supply.   2. Turn Off the Main Water Valve: If the under-sink valves fail, locate your home’s main water shutoff (usually in the basement, utility closet, or near the street meter) and turn it off to stop all water flow to the house.
  3. Cut the Power: If the pooling water is anywhere near electrical outlets, under-sink lighting, or a garbage disposal unit, safely flip the circuit breaker to that specific room.
  4. Start Water Extraction: Use a wet/dry shop vacuum, heavy mop, and thick towels to soak up as much standing water as possible to protect your baseboards and subflooring.

Why Denver's Climate Causes Under-Sink Pipe Failures​

Homeowners in the Mile High City face unique environmental challenges. The primary culprit for a burst supply line is extreme temperature fluctuation. During bitter winter cold snaps, pipes located against poorly insulated exterior walls can freeze. As the water turns to ice, it expands, creating immense pressure that ruptures braided steel hoses, PVC, or old copper lines.

Furthermore, homes in historic Denver neighborhoods, particularly around the 80209 and 80202 ZIP codes, often still rely on aging angle stop valves and brittle supply lines that degrade over time. Common Mistakes Homeowners Make During a Plumbing Panic​

In the chaos of a flooded kitchen, it is easy to make matters worse. Avoid these frequent missteps:

  • Using Duct Tape or Putty: Wrapping tape around a high-pressure water line will only hold for a few minutes before blowing out again. You need a mechanical fix, not a superficial patch.
  • Ignoring the Baseboards: Wiping up the visible puddle isn't enough. Water seeps under the cabinetry and baseboards, creating a breeding ground for toxic mold if not professionally assessed.

Expert Tips to Prevent Frozen Pipes Under Sinks​

The best way to handle a plumbing leak is to prevent it from happening in the first place. When the Denver forecast predicts subzero temperatures, use these expert strategies:

  • Open Cabinet Doors: Leave the cabinet doors under your kitchen and bathroom sinks wide open overnight. This allows your home's warm ambient air to circulate around the exposed pipes.
  • Let the Faucet Drip: Allow a tiny trickle of both hot and cold water to run from the faucet. Moving water is significantly less likely to freeze in the lines.
  • Insulate Exposed Lines: Wrap any pipes located on exterior walls with foam pipe insulation tape or sleeves.

Q2: Is a leaking under-sink pipe considered an emergency? Absolutely. Because these are pressurized supply lines, they can pump hundreds of gallons of water into your home in just a few hours, destroying flooring, drywall, and personal property.

Q3: Does my homeowner's insurance cover a burst pipe? Most standard policies cover sudden and accidental water damage, including burst pipes. However, they typically do not cover the cost of repairing the plumbing component itself.
